Ravindra Jadeja and Kuldeep Yadav Hopeful For Hunting In Pair
Left-arm spinners Kuldeep Yadav and Ravindra Jadeja wreaked havoc on the West Indies batting lineup, bowling them out for just 114 runs in the first ODI. Kuldeep was the pick of the bowlers, taking 4 wickets for just 6 runs in his 3 overs. He was particularly effective in the middle overs when he took […]

On This Day: Brian Lara’s 12th Test century pins down Australia
Exactly 19 years ago, during the third Test of Australia’s tour of West Indies in 1999 at Bridgetown, Barbados, Brian Lara scored his 12th Test century as West Indies defeated Australia in a dramatic fashion. Having lost the last Test by 10 wickets at Kingston, Steve Waugh, the then Australian captain, had won the toss […]
